One of the primary advantages of using an Indoor Fiber Patch Cord is its excellent resistance to electromagnetic interference (EMI) and radio frequency interference (RFI). Unlike traditional copper cables, the Optical Fiber Patch Cable transmits data through light rather than electrical signals, making it immune to noise and external disturbances. This characteristic makes the Fiber Optic Jumper Cable particularly valuable in environments with high electrical interference, such as industrial settings or densely packed data centers.

Technical Parameters:

Product Name Indoor Fiber Patch Cord
Type Fiber Optic Network Cable
Connector Type LC to LC Fiber Cable
Fiber Mode Single Mode / Multimode
Jacket Material LSZH / PVC
Insertion Loss < 0.3 dB
Return Loss > 50 dB
Operating Temperature -40°C to 85°C
Cable Length 1m / 2m / 3m / Custom

Our Fiber Optic Patch Cables are designed to provide high-performance connectivity for a variety of networking applications. To ensure optimal performance and durability, please handle the cables with care and avoid excessive bending or pulling.

If you experience any issues with your Fiber Optic Patch Cable, please verify that the connectors are clean and properly seated. Use appropriate fiber optic cleaning tools to maintain connector end faces.

For installation, follow standard fiber optic handling procedures to prevent damage. Ensure that the cable bend radius is not exceeded and avoid exposure to harsh environmental conditions unless the cable is rated for such use.
